................i have found some housing but the leases are only for a whole year.
Anyone with a property available for a year will talk to you about 6 months. Maybe they will want 70% of the yearly rent.
i sort of understand the visa situation, but was looking for any alternative options for hosuing around legian, seminyak maybe even sanur.
You need to be here when looking - don't try and finalize a rental using only the Internet. So plan on 2-3 weeks in a low cost hotel in your favorite area.

I am currently renting an apartment for the month in Seminyak. Small, but nice quiet area, free wi-fi, a pool, nicely decorated and clean. Walking distance to the beach. It is 5 million rupiah a month which includes electricity. This may seem steep considering what you can get houses for with yearly contracts but if you are having trouble finding a six-month rental, this might be an option as they rent month to month.
